UNIQLO Vancouver store opening this fall



The wait is over, Vancouver – UNIQLO has officially announced the arrival of its first BC store for fall 2017.

The global Japanese retailer, popular for its casual apparel, will be opening a 20,000 sq. ft. store at Metrotown in Burnaby, its third location in Canada after two locations in Toronto were opened in late 2016.


The new UNIQLO store will offer the brand’s full range of core items for men, women, kids, and babies.

“The launch of UNIQLO in British Columbia represents another major milestone for us, as Canada continues to be an important focus for the company globally,” Yasuhiro Hayashi, COO of UNIQLO Canada, said in a release. “This country’s cultural and climatic diversity represents the perfect platform for UNIQLO and our philosophy of LifeWear.”



“We are extremely excited to share UNIQLO with the people of Vancouver and surrounding areas and introduce them to how our high quality, comfortable and functional clothing can help improve their everyday lives. With the opportunity for outdoor adventures to world-class amenities, we hope that Vancouverites will embrace UNIQLO’s versatile and stylish everyday clothes that cater to their active lifestyle.”

Expect such UNIQLO staples as ultra light down jackets, affordable cashmere, and their line of HEATTECH innerwear.

If you want to keep the excitement going, check out photos from the opening of UNIQLO’s Toronto store last year to get a sense of what Vancouver is in for.

UNIQLO Vancouver store opening

When: Fall 2017

Where: Metropolis at Metrotown – 4700 Kingsway, Burnaby
